Chiefs notes: Flowers near
The Chiefs drafted Brandon Flowers hoping he could eventually be their first home-grown Pro Bowl cornerback since Dale Carter more than a decade ago.

They wanted Flowers, who will replace Ty Law in the lineup, in training camp on time, and there were signs Tuesday that a contract agreement was near.
“We’re getting close,” said Flowers’ agent, Andy Ross. “We’ve been talking. I think we’ll be able to finish it up (today).”
The Chiefs drafted Flowers early in the second round. He and Patrick Surtain are the starters, but another rookie, fifth-round pick Brandon Carr, could eventually push Surtain for a starting spot.
The Chiefs continued to work on contract agreements with their two first-round picks, defensive tackle Glenn Dorsey and offensive linemen Branden Albert.
Training camp begins Friday in River Falls, Wis.

Just an FYI....

Draft picks are not allowed to participate in training camp in any way because they techinically are not part of the team. The NFL and the player's union have put this into the league rules to avoid injuries or strong-arming by one side or the other.

Also, once a draft pick signs, he likely will be among the top 53 paid players on the team which will affect the salary cap. So having a player participate in training camp (in any way) that is not under contract circumventing the salary cap. Hence the rule.

So Alberts can say he will be there contract or not. But the closest he can come to camp is at a Motel 8 down the road until he signs his name at the bottom of the page.
